Xiaomi Mi4 64GB available for Rs. 17,999 for one day, and you can get up to Rs. 5,000 off on exchange of your old phone

Yesterday, we told you that the Xiaomi Mi 4 would be getting a special price cut for one day, in celebration of the company’s 1st anniversary in India.

And today, the company has made it official.

The Mi 4 sports a 5-inch Full HD Display, and is powered by a 2.5GHz Snapdragon 801 processor and 3GB of RAM. It sports a 13 megapixel rear camera with LED Flash and an f/1,8 aperture, and an 8 megapixel front camera with auto-focus. Both cameras make use of Sony sensors. The phone runs on MIUI 6 based on Android 4.4 KitKat, and packs a 3,080mAh battery.

The Xiaomi Mi4 64GB is currently available for Rs. 17,999 for one day only, and the sale is held exclusively on Flipkart. And the online retailer is also offering an exchange scheme, with which you can get up to Rs. 5,000 off on exchange of your old phone. That brings the price down to just Rs. 12,999.

It is an open sale, and lets be honest, I don’t think there will be a better price for the Mi 4. So, this is a great time to buy the flagship phone.
